As you all knows that all circuit breakers can be called
as on off switch with some safety device ie ACB make and
break contact in air (one moving and one sliding) so it
called air circuit breaker for safety we use in ACB Under
voltage shunt trip closing unit. CBCT for tripping command
relay with over voltage earth fault etc for spring charge
we use motor charging mechanism. Same case with VCB
contacts makes in vacuum to minimize the arc during make
and break contact (one moving and one sliding) on high
voltage other function are same but according to the
voltage rating
